San Francisco Welcomes Deb Price and Joyce Murdoch

Journalists Deb Price and Joyce Murdoch are the authors of the groundbreaking
"Courting Justice: Gay Men and Lesbians v. the Supreme Court," a 50-year history of
how the U.S. Supreme Court has dealt with gay rights. The book won the 2002 Lambda
Literary Foundation award for gay studies. And The Washington Post's Book World
hailed it as one of its "Raves and Faves" of 2001.

Deb and Joyce also authored the award-winning "And Say Hi to Joyce: America's First
Gay Column Comes Out," which tells the inspiring story of Deb's pioneering newspaper
column. They’ve appeared on Oprah, the Phil Donahue Show, and have spoken at
countless events, including at Yale Law School and the Library of Congress.

Joyce, a former Washington Post editor and reporter, is now a managing editor of
politics at National Journal magazine, the weekly political bible for Washington
insiders. She is also a 2005 Hoover Institution Media Fellow. Deb, a Washington
correspondent for The Detroit News, has been writing the first nationally syndicated
column on gay and lesbian issues in mainstream newspapers for nearly 13 years.

Deb and Joyce were married on June 27, 2003 in Toronto City Hall. Soon afterward,
they became the first same-sex couple to appear on The Washington Post's
Engagements, Weddings and Anniversaries pages. A year later, Deb and Joyce became
the first gay couple to announce a wedding anniversary in The Washington Post, which
included a photograph of them wearing leis on their Hawaiian honeymoon. They are
celebrating their 20th anniversary as a couple this June with a trip to Hong Kong
and Bali.
